How does a slewing bearing work?

Slewing bearings comprise an inner ring and an outer ring, one of which usually incorporates a gear. Together with attachment holes in both rings, they enable an optimized power transmission with a simple and quick connection between adjacent machine components.

How do you measure a slewing bearing?

Place the slewing bearing on the platform vertically, lift a slewing ring, Measure the clearance with the dead weight of the other slewing ring, Measure three point along the circumference of 120° and take the average . Other measurements are allowed.

What is a slewing assembly?

The slewing drive is a gearbox that can safely hold radial and axial loads, as well as transmit a torque for rotating. Slewing drives are made by manufacturing gearing, bearings, seals, housing, motor and other auxiliary components and assembling them into a finished gearbox.

What is rocking test of Crane?

The rocking test comprises the measurement of the deflection between the crane pedestal and the rotating crane housing in the way of the slewing ring using a dial test indicator to determine the bearing clearances.

What is a slew motor?

Slew motors, also referred to as swing motors or swing drive motors, provide rotation. For example, a slew motor is what enables the house of a mini excavator to rotate 360°. On excavators (wheeled, tracked, and compact), they are usually axial piston hydraulic motors.

What is slewing in an excavator?

Slewing refers to rotating the excavator’s house assembly. Unlike a conventional backhoe, the operator can slew the entire house and workgroup upon the undercarriage for spoil placement.

Why do you use slewing ring bearings instead of two?

A slewing ring bearing has rolling elements designed to create a reactive moment within the bearing’s dimensions envelope, to oppose applied (overturning) moment load. This makes it practical to use one bearing instead of two, reducing the height required for an application and often improving performance.
